Subject: Re: [PATCH v2] KVM: Avoid zapping unrelated shadows in __kvm_set_memory_region()

On 04/10/2012 09:05 PM, Takuya Yoshikawa wrote:
> di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c b/ar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c
> index 29ad6f9..a50f7ba 100644
> --- a/ar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c
> +++ b/ar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c
> @@ -3930,16 +3930,30 @@ void kvm_mmu_slot_remove_write_access(struct kvm *kvm, int slot)
> kvm_flush_remote_tlbs(kvm);
> }
>
> -void kvm_mmu_zap_all(struct kvm *kvm)
> +/**
> + * kvm_mmu_zap_all - zap all shadows which have mappings into a given slot
> + * @kvm: the kvm instance
> + * @slot: id of the target slot
> + *
> + * If @slot is -1, zap all shadow pages.
> + */
> +void kvm_mmu_zap_all(struct kvm *kvm, int slot)
> {
> struct kvm_mmu_page *sp, *node;
> LIST_HEAD(invalid_list);
> + int zapped;
>
> spin_lock(&kvm->mmu_lock);
> restart:
> - list_for_each_entry_safe(sp, node, &kvm->arch.active_mmu_pages, link)
> - if (kvm_mmu_prepare_zap_page(kvm, sp, &invalid_list))
> - goto restart;
> + zapped = 0;
> + list_for_each_entry_safe(sp, node, &kvm->arch.active_mmu_pages, link) {
> + if ((slot >= 0) && !test_bit(slot, sp->slot_bitmap))
> + continue;
> +
> + zapped |= kvm_mmu_prepare_zap_page(kvm, sp, &invalid_list);
You should "goto restart" here like the origin code, also, "safe" version of
list_for_each is not needed.
